Description:
|
A map of a part of Moray, from Fochabers and the River Spey in the east, extending westwards to Hart Hill and south as far as Orton House. There is much settlement detail, with prominent likenesses of some houses, castles and ecclesiastical buildings around the former Loch of Spynie. The map was catalogued by C.G. Cash as part of the manuscript maps compiled by Robert Gordon. In fact, it was compiled largely by Timothy Pont in the last two decades of the sixteenth century. Robert Gordon's handwriting occurs almost exclusively east of the Spey and close to his home, where it is easily distinguished from that of Pont.
